Occupational Therapy Groups

For children and youth, OT can help support skills development at home and school. Support for skills development can look like: fine motor, printing, gross motor, self regulation, sensory regulation, sleep routines, hygiene, social skills, etc. OT’s also consider how to modify task or the environment to make it a just right challenge.

Dungeons & Dragons – Beginner Group

Join in on our Dungeons & Dragons adventure, where imagination meets real-life learning! In this fun and interactive group, kids will embark on epic adventures while building essential social communication skills like teamwork, communication, problem-solving, and conflict resolution.

Through collaborative storytelling and role-playing, children will grow in confidence, practice empathy, and improve their ability to work together and make friends.

New to D&D? This group is for you! We will walk you through basic character creation and gameplay. Bring your imagination and get ready to step into a whole new world.

The flow, materials, activities, and program environment are specifically curated and designed to support a wide range of social, communicative, and emotional needs.

All our activities embed the fundamentals of socialskilled, which are: learning and working with others, making friends, and keeping friends.

Social goals are responsive to the needs of the participants and may include: Respecting personal space and feelings; Contributing to a group; Taking turns; Accepting differences; Joining activities/Trying something new.
